QID 356436: Amazon Linux Security Advisory for libtiff : ALAS2-2023-2300
There exists one heap buffer overflow in _tiffmemcpy in tif_unix.c in libtiff 4.0.10, which allows an attacker to cause a denial-of-service through a crafted tiff file. (
( CVE-2020-18768) a heap buffer overflow in extractimagesection function in tiffcrop.c in libtiff library version 4.3.0 allows attacker to trigger unsafe or out of bounds memory access via crafted tiff image file which could result into application crash, potential information disclosure or any other context-dependent impact (cve-2022-0891) a heap-buffer-overflow vulnerability was found in libtiff, in extractimagesection() at tools/tiffcrop.c:7916 and tools/tiffcrop.c:7801.
This flaw allows attackers to cause a denial of service via a crafted tiff file. (
( CVE-2023-3164)
